The Revelation of St John (Apocalypse), c1498. The Adoration of the Lamb and the Hymn of the Chosen. Making a square around the circle of the Lamb of God, Jesus Christ, are the winged symbols of the four evangelists, Mark, Matthew, Luke, and John

This print showcases "The Revelation of St John (Apocalypse)" by the renowned artist Albrecht Durer. Created in 1498, this medieval masterpiece depicts a profound religious concept that has captivated audiences for centuries. At the center of the composition, we see the Lamb of God, Jesus Christ, surrounded by a square formed by four winged symbols representing the evangelists Mark, Matthew, Luke, and John. This symbolic arrangement emphasizes their role in spreading the message of Christianity. Durer's woodcut technique brings depth and texture to this intricate artwork. The monochrome palette adds a sense of timelessness to the piece while highlighting its meticulous details. "The Revelation of St John" explores themes such as judgment and adoration within Christian theology. It serves as a visual representation of concepts related to eschatology and the Day of Judgment. Originating from Germany during the fifteenth century, this German religious art exemplifies Durer's exceptional talent and his ability to convey complex ideas through visual storytelling. This remarkable print is not only an artistic treasure but also offers viewers an opportunity for contemplation on faith and spirituality. Its enduring appeal continues to inspire awe among those who appreciate both medieval artistry and religious symbolism.
